Pressure 01

Forecasts lag the field and arrive after corrective action gets expensive.

Pressure 02

Production, cost, and billing data live in separate tools and spreadsheets.

Pressure 03

PM judgment is valuable but hard to compare against actuals and system-generated projections.

Implementation Pathway

From workflow diagnosis to controlled proof

The same Artemis method adapts to the audience: start with a real decision loop, prove the evidence chain safely, then train the operating cadence.

Step 01

Diagnose

Diagnose the operating workflow and identify the highest-value decision loop.

Step 02

Map

Map the source systems, documents, models, and human review gates.

Step 03

Prototype

Build a controlled prototype with synthetic or approved data before any private rollout.

Step 04

Operationalize

Train the team, measure adoption, and convert the prototype into an operating cadence.
